// Setting up the Gribblediff client for big-file mode.
// Heads up: files over 200 MB get chunked server-side, so your plugin
// should stream hunks rather than loading the whole diff into memory.
// The viewer falls back to a binary summary if tokenization times out,
// which is fine — don't retry in a loop, the Plonkworth gateway will
// throttle you. Rendering hooks fire once per chunk. To talk to the
// internal chunking service, the client needs the key below.

service key, fawip-bajef: kto11_Qt5wZK9vdNC

Handover: Thornbury dispatch

Taking a week off; you own the driver-assignment heuristic in the Thornbury dispatch service. Known issue: the proximity weight overcounts drivers idling near the Westmarch depot, so assignments cluster there during morning peak. Mitigation is live — a decay factor on idle time — but it's tuned by hand and drifts. If assignment latency alarms fire, check the heuristic weights first, not the queue. Rollback is safe; last stable build is tagged in the repo. Current production weights are as follows.

config for bahof-tagep:
kelael:
  pin: 3701
  tenant: fraius
  seal: seal_566287a7
  metrics_host: metrics.kelael.ferradyn.local
  standby_team: sormir
  escalation: juldor-oliir
  nonce: 530523

Registry enforces BACKWARD compat
# for all topics under events.ledger.*
#
# cache_ttl_seconds: keep at 300 in staging, 900 in prod.
# reject_unknown_fields: must stay true; Orbitloom consumers
# will silently drop malformed envelopes otherwise.
#
# Registry state persists to the Hollowpine metadata store.
# The registry service reads its backing store from the
# connection string below.

replica DSN, kajep-yahag: mssql://praok_svc:iF@db-8d68.plorvaio.local:5432/eliion

For the Ledgerwing billing worker, blue-green deploys require both colors to drain in-flight invoice batches before traffic flips. We hold the old environment warm until the settlement queue reaches zero or a hard timeout elapses, whichever comes first. These thresholds were validated during the Marrowgate load trials and should be revisited after any queue-broker upgrade. The relevant cutover constants are defined as follows.

tuning table, kahop-tawig:
CAPS = {
    "aldix": 1008,
    "oliax": 81,
    "casok": 299,
    "sordor": 409,
    "sormir": 822,
}